Regulatory Authority of Betting Sites in Tanzania

The regulatory body in Tanzania is the Gaming Board of Tanzania as provided by the Gaming Act Cap. The Gambling Commission of Ireland established in 2003 is the principal regulatory body that has the mandate of regulating gambling activities. Its responsibilities include:

  • Granting of different kinds of gaming permits.
  • Supervising over and controlling of the gaming activities.
  • Protecting the law and ethical rules.

The Board has an important function to ensure the proper and fair functioning of gambling business in Tanzania.

Prohibited and Permitted Bets

Tanzania allows several types of gaming activities, including:

  • Sports Betting (Online and at the Physical Shops)
  • Online Casino Games
  • Virtual Games
  • Scratch Cards

Nevertheless, operating games without a license is unlawful and punishable by a fine or imprisonment. The law has offered detailed descriptions of what constitutes gaming activities to prevent proliferation of the activities in society.

The Key Facts on Gambling Licenses and Fees

The Gaming Board of Tanzania offers various licenses for different types of gambling operations:

  • Casino License
  • Slot Machine License
  • Sports Betting License
  • Lottery License
  • Bingo License

For online and electronic gambling, the licenses include:For online and electronic gambling, the licenses include:

  • Internet Casino License
  • License for SMS and Online Lottery
  • Internet Sports Betting License
  • Virtual Sports Betting License

The minimum registered capital of a local company is US$300,000 while that of a foreign company is US$500,000. Such rules and regulations also make it hard for unprofessional and unprepared operators to venture into the market.

The Taxation Landscape

Gambling activities in Tanzania are subject to various taxes:

  • The tax rate for Sports Betting and Online Betting is 25% of GGR, and an additional 15% on net winnings.
  • SMS Lotteries and Internet Casino Operations are also subjected to GGR tax of 25 percent while net winnings attract 15 percent tax.
  • Street Slot Machines are subject to a monthly charge of TZS 100,000 per machine together with 15% of net winnings.
  • National Lotteries are taxed at 20% of GGR and an additional 15% on the net winnings.
  • Casino Operations are subjected to an 18% GGR tax weekly while the land based Casinos are subjected to a 12% tax on net winnings.
  • Virtual Games are taxed at 10% of GGR, and an extra 15% on the net winnings.

These taxes greatly help in the national revenue and are used for many causes of development.
